Get Certified: Your Guide to Obtaining a Security Guard License

Pursuing a career as a security guard can offer stability. But before you secure the premises, you'll need to receive your license. This process varies from state to state, but there are common steps involved. First, you'll have to fulfill the minimum age and education/experience requirements. Next, you'll likely need to finish a recognized training program. This curriculum will teach you with the knowledge necessary to execute your duties as a security guard, such as crowd control, surveillance, and emergency response. Once you've finished your training, you'll become prepared to request your license. Be sure to examine the particular rules for your state. The licensing system can appear complex, however. By following these steps, you'll be well on your way to becoming a licensed security guard.

A Successful Career Security Guard

Pursuing a career as a security guard presents an opportunity to maintain the safety and well-being of individuals and property. However, it's not just about observing. To truly succeed in this challenging role, aspiring security guards must develop a specific set of crucial skills.

  • Effective Communication: The ability to communicate information accurately is paramount. Security guards often need to engage with the public, fellow officers, and emergency services, requiring written communication skills.
  • Observant: A heightened sense of perception of surroundings is essential for detecting potential threats or suspicious activity. This involves interpreting information and acting accordingly.
  • Stamina: Security guards may need to patrol for long periods, intervene in emergency situations, or even engage in physical altercations. Therefore, a good level of strength is crucial.
  • Decision-Making: Security guards often face unexpected situations that require quick thinking. They must be able to evaluate problems, identify potential risks, and make appropriate decisions.
  • Integrity: Maintaining a high level of professionalism is critical in this role. This includes conducting oneself with respect, following to ethical standards, and staying calm under pressure.
